Facial Rejuvenation

Facial Rejuvenation is one of the advanced cosmetic skin treatments available at our clinic. The treatment is designed to refresh the face, improve skin texture, reduce dullness, soften fine lines, restore glow, and give the skin a healthier and younger-looking appearance. It may include different skin procedures depending on the patient’s age, skin type, concern, and desired results.

The fast pace of life, stress, pollution, sun exposure, ageing, poor sleep, hormonal changes, and improper skincare habits can make the face appear tired, dull, dry, uneven, and aged. Over time, the skin may lose collagen, elasticity, hydration, and natural brightness. Facial Rejuvenation helps improve the overall quality of the skin by targeting concerns such as fine lines, pigmentation, open pores, rough texture, sagging, and loss of freshness.

Facial Rejuvenation is not a single treatment for every patient because each face ages differently. Some patients may need hydration and glow improvement, while others may need treatment for wrinkles, pigmentation, volume loss, scars, or skin laxity. Does Facial Rejuvenation hurt?

The level of discomfort during Facial Rejuvenation depends on the procedure performed. Treatments such as hydrafacial, oxyfacial, and carbon facial are usually comfortable and relaxing. Procedures such as microneedling, laser, Botox, fillers, or PRP may cause mild pricking, warmth, pressure, or temporary discomfort.

To improve comfort, numbing cream may be applied before certain procedures. Most patients tolerate Facial Rejuvenation treatments well when performed under proper guidance. What are the possible side effects?

Facial Rejuvenation may have mild and temporary side effects depending on the treatment performed. Some patients may experience redness, swelling, dryness, mild peeling, temporary sensitivity, bruising, tingling, or slight discomfort after the procedure.

These side effects usually settle with proper aftercare. The risk of side effects can be reduced when the treatment is performed by trained professionals and when patients follow the aftercare instructions correctly.
